AI Obstacle Avoidance

The most effective robot vacuums utilize various sensors to stay clear of obstacles and navigate the home. Distance sensors emit laser beams which measure the time required for the light to bounce off furniture and walls to create a map. This allows the robots to identify and steer clear of objects and ensure a safe cleaning process.

Other robots use 3D Time of Flight (ToF) imaging to scan the surrounding area and identify obstacles. This technology is also used in smart home cameras and is based on sending out a series of light pulses that are then examined to determine the height, depth and dimensions of objects. It is less accurate than other mapping techniques and could be unable to distinguish reflective or transparent surfaces.

Some robotic cleaners use, in addition to traditional sensor technology to detect and avoid obstacles, employ advanced AI. ECOVACS robots for instance have AIVI 3D which can accurately detect obstacles and ensure an easy, accident-free cleaning process. This software is able to work in the dark and allow users to enjoy a clean home overnight or while they are watching television.

Robotic cleaners can also steer clear of obstacles using monocular and binocular vision. They capture images, analyze them and determine what they are. This feature can help the robot avoid hitting objects such as furniture legs or toys, and can save you a amount of trouble. This type of obstacle detection isn't as efficient as lasers or 3-D imaging. It could result in the robot getting stuck under furniture, or even missing parts of the room.

Mapping is one of the main features of robot vacuums, which improve navigation and ensure an efficient cleaning. Before you enable the mapping feature it is essential to prepare your home by removing objects that are loose as well as moving furniture and secure any cables. If you are able, also optimize and improve the arrangement of your home. This will allow the robot to better comprehend the area and navigate more efficiently. Once the mapping is completed, it will be stored inside the robot and will be used each time you run it.

Suction Power

Suction power - measured in Pascals (Pa) - is the force that holds the robot's bristles or rollers to the automatic floor vacuum, pulling up grime and directing it into the dustbin. It is crucial to determine your needs for cleaning and compare models based on suction strength before committing to purchase.

For the majority of homes, a minimum of 2500 Pa is sufficient to maintain floors that have a mix of hard and soft flooring types. If you have carpets as your primary flooring choose models of high-end quality with up to 11,000 Pa of power for effective whole-home deep cleaning.

Most budget-friendly robotic vacuum cleaners come with two or three rotors that create a vacuum like suction to remove hair, dirt and other debris from the floor. They then place it in their dustbin. These models are made to clean hard floors and low pile area rug. The more expensive models come with extra brushes that do not tangle and can reach into corners.

If you have a variety of flooring types in your home, look for a model with different suction levels that adjust to the type of surface. This allows you adjust the suction levels to suit your needs and protects your sensitive floors from damage.

A self-emptying robot vacuum with an enormous dustbin is a further method to reduce the amount of dust inside your robot vac. They empty their dust bins after every cleaning cycle to prevent the buildup of hair that is tangled and other particles that could reduce the unit's performance.

Remember that higher suction power vacuum cleaners need longer run times for each cleaning session. However, they also collect debris more quickly and fill their dustbins much more often. Therefore, it's important to weigh the pros and cons of cleaning efficiency and battery runtime, noise, and robotic vacuum cleaners frequency of dust bin filling.
